Viral Vectors

Microbes have developed to seamlessly introduce DNA sequences into recipient cells, establishing them as a viable method for genetic modification. Common virus-based carriers include:

Adenoviral vectors – Designed to invade both proliferating and static cells but may provoke immunogenic reactions.

AAV vectors – Favorable due to their minimal antigenicity and ability to sustain extended DNA transcription.

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the host genome, offering sustained transcription, with lentiviruses being particularly advantageous for modifying quiescent cells.

Non-Viral Vectors

Alternative gene transport techniques present a less immunogenic choice,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These encompass:

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Packaging DNA or RNA for effective intracellular transport.

Electroporation – Employing electrostimulation to generate permeable spots in cell membranes, permitting nucleic acid infiltration.

Direct Injection –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

DNA-Based Therapy: Rewriting the Human DNA

Gene therapy works by altering the root cause of DNA-related illnesses:

In Vivo Gene Therapy: Administers genetic material immediately within the organism, such as the government-sanctioned vision-restoring Luxturna for ameliorating congenital sight impairment.

Cell-Extraction Gene Treatment: Involves editing a biological samples externally and then reintroducing them, as evidenced by some experimental treatments for red blood cell disorders and immune system failures.

The advent of cutting-edge CRISPR technology has further accelerated gene therapy research, allowing for targeted alterations at the genetic scale.
